2‐Aryl‐dibenzo‐1,2‐oxaphosphorine as a ligand in borane and in Pt(II) complexes
Authors:Gyö  rgy Keglevich,Helga Szelke,Andrea Keré  nyi,Tí  mea Imre,Krisztina Ludá  nyi,Jó  zsef Dukai,Ferenc Nagy,Pé  ter Ará  nyi
Abstract:Optimum conditions for the synthesis of aryl‐dibenzo‐oxaphosphorines ( 2 ) from the corresponding phosphonous chloride ( 1 ) were explored to avoid the formation of by‐products (e.g., 4–6 ). The aryl‐dibenzo‐oxaphosphorines ( 2 ) were converted to the P‐oxides ( 3 ), and were utilized in the synthesis of phosphinite‐boranes 7 and Pt(II) complexes 8 . Depending on the aryl substituent, the Pt(II) complex ( 8 ) was formed with cis and trans geometry. © 2004 Wiley Periodicals, Inc.
